James Jonkel, Wildlife Management Specialist, Montana Fish, Wildlife & Parks
Jamie brings over 50 years of experience with wildlife management and conflict reduction to his position with Montana Fish, Wildlife and Parks. He has worked in Montana, Idaho, Wyoming, Alaska, New Mexico, Canada and Russia with various private and public entities including: National Geographic, Hornocker Wildlife Research Institute, Glacier Institute, Interagency Grizzly Bear Study, Glacier National Park Wolf Ecology Project, Idaho Fish and Game, Maine Fish and Wildlife, Border Grizzly Bear Project, and several privately-owned ranches. He has been with Montana Fish, Wildlife and Parks since 1996. Jamie received his Bachelors in Wildlife Biology and a minor in Journalism from the University of Montana in Missoula.

Torrey Ritter, FWP nongame biologist based out of Missoula, will speak on:
FWP’s Nongame Wildlife Program and Key Nongame Species in the Ninemile Valley
Torrey will talk about the structure and function of FWP’s nongame wildlife program, including the primary goals of the program, how the program is funded, what guides our work, and examples of specific projects we work on. Torrey will provide a brief overview of the major nongame work going on in west-central Montana, then focus in on the Ninemile Valley and talk about specific habitat types, special habitat patches, and focal species relevant to the Ninemile Valley.
Adopt-a-Highway
The Ninemile Wildlife Workgroup has been cleaning a two mile section of old Highway 10 for the past 13 years. As road sections go, this one is pretty sweet, much of it in riparian habitat with little traffic and not too much trash (especially if you don’t count beverage containers). Every year brings a bonus surprise of new wildlife observations, a lost tool or treasure, or even lost cash.
